Subject: Key rotation for the Lumira FX conversion service

Team,

We traced last week's rounding discrepancies to stale cached rates in the Lumira FX converter. The fix rounds at the final ledger step only, using banker's rounding, which resolves the off-by-one-cent tickets. As part of the deploy we rotated the service credential, so any saved copies in your support tooling are now invalid. Please update your local configuration today. The new key for the converter endpoint is below.

gateway credential: kto3_qfe

Ticket: Staging env misconfigured for Siftgate bloom filter

The bloom layer in front of the Pellet KV store is rejecting all lookups in staging because the env file was copied from the dev template without credentials. False-positive tuning values are fine; only the auth line is missing. To unblock the weekly demo, the Pellet admission secret must be set on the following line.

env line for yaguf-fajop: LEDGER_TOKEN13=fb08984397349

**Handover — Hardware Lab Access**

Hi Priya — before I head off, here's the lab situation. The Brindlecote hardware lab is badge-only, but half the team's badges still aren't provisioned after the move, so people will keep coming to you. Send provisioning requests to facilities with the person's start date; turnaround is about two days. The soldering bench stays locked regardless — keys are in the top drawer. For anyone stuck in the meantime, the door keypad accepts the code below.

turnstile pass: bdg-R-53